Re: 1983 CJ7 Neutral Safety Switch - Manual Trans
The neutral safety switch on my '83 CJ-7 (automatic) connects the line to ground when the transmission was in park or neutral, which ultimately provides the ground for the fender-mounted starter solenoid. Re: Snorkel
To be clear, if your exhaust system is toast, that has nothing to do with installing a snorkel. A snorkel is for raising the air intake higher to avoid sucking water into the engine, which would only happen if you get into something approaching hood-high water.
